Data on thrombolysis outcomes in patients with primary brain tumors are limited. Our aim was to study stroke outcomes following thrombolysis in these patients in a population-based study. Patients with acute ischemic stroke who received thrombolysis were identified from the 2002-2011 USA Nationwide Inpatient Sample. ⋯ Thrombolytic therapy for acute stroke appears to be safe in patients with primary brain tumors, with similar rates of ICH. Malignant BTS have worse outcomes, while benign BTS have outcomes comparable to NBTS. Careful consideration of tumor pathology may aid selection of patients with poor thrombolysis outcomes.

The aim of this study was to compare reoperation, complication rates, and healthcare resource utilization of expansile laminectomies with instrumented fusion versus laminoplasty. Using the MarketScan database (Truven Health Analytics, Ann Arbor, MI, USA), we selected patients aged >18 years who underwent either cervical laminoplasty or laminectomy with fusion between 2000-2009. Propensity score modeling produced a matched cohort balanced for age, sex, comorbidities, and other relevant factors. ⋯ They also had lower costs (United States dollars) during index hospitalization ($26,129 versus $35,483, p<0.0004), and overall during the 2 year postoperative period ($77,960 versus $106,453, p<0.0001). Two year reoperation rates were similar between both groups (9.77% versus 7.36%, p=0.20). Our study suggests that cervical laminoplasty has significantly lower complication rates, similar long-term reoperation rates and lower healthcare resource utilization after 2 years than laminectomy with fusion.

Lower mean hemoglobin (HGB) levels are associated with unfavorable outcome after spontaneous subarachnoid hemorrhage (SAH). Currently, there is no cutoff level for mean HGB levels associated with unfavorable outcome. This study was conducted to evaluate a threshold for mean HGB concentrations after SAH, and to observe the relation to outcome. ⋯ The highest Youden's index value was found for a HGB cutoff at 11.1 g/dl. In a binary logistic regression model, predictors of unfavorable outcome were identified as an initially high Hunt-Hess grade (odds ratio [OR]: 7.7; 95% confidence interval [CI]: 4.4-13.4; p<0.001), cerebral infarction on a CT scan during hospital stay (OR: 3.8; 95% CI: 2.0-7.3; p<0.001), rebleeding during the hospital stay (OR: 3.5; 95% CI: 1.6-8.0; p=0.002), mean HGB concentration <11.1g/dl (OR: 3.3; 95% CI: 2.0-5.3; p<0.001), and hydrocephalus (OR: 2.3; 95% CI: 1.4-3.7; p=0.001). In conclusion, a mean HGB concentration <11.1 g/dl during the hospital stay was associated with unfavorable outcome after acute SAH.
